What "leading the ECO" really means

An Emergency situation Control Organisation is the framework that manages an occurrence inside a center up until the arrival of external -responders. In a little workplace that may be a chief warden, an interactions warden, and 2 area wardens. In a hospital it may be loads of wardens throughout several areas, each with deputies, joggers, and first aiders.

PUAFER006 identifies that leading this team is an unique responsibility. Where PUAFER005 Operate as part of an emergency control organisation focuses on specific warden tasks, PUAFER006 anticipates you to set approach, allot jobs, and control information. During a smoke occasion from a server room, for example, the chief warden needs to figure out whether to leave, stage a sanctuary in place, or isolate and display. That telephone call hinges on input from wardens, the panel, facility systems, and your very own risk judgment.

I have actually seen brand-new principal wardens wait for best information and shed a critical min of momentum. Similarly, I have actually seen brash wardens call a full discharge for a scorched salute alarm system and cause crowding on staircases that put individuals at greater risk. Leading the ECO has to do with stabilizing action with confirmation within clear plans.

The competency back of PUAFER006

The system breaks down into a collection of demonstrable abilities that, together, form the backbone of reliable incident control. Instructors might package them in a different way, yet the material remains consistent.

Leadership under unpredictability. You require to provide concise guidelines when indications are insufficient. That suggests setting a preliminary pose, for example, "explore and standby," then rising or de‑escalating as details is available in. The best principal wardens narrate choices in ordinary language so the group comprehends intent.

Information administration. Alarm panels, CCTV, wardens' records, passenger phone calls, BMS notifications, and professional inputs all compete for interest. A functional technique is to assign a single communications point, generally at the Emergency Control Point, and standardise message styles: area, nature, actions taken, sources needed. It seems basic, yet disciplined wording conserves minutes and prevents duplication.

Resource coordination. You route wardens, first aiders, protection, and occasionally service providers. That consists of positioning, alleviation, and safety for the ECO itself. Throughout a chemical spill on a warehouse flooring, we rotated wardens at five‑minute intervals due to fumes in the external area. Without that rotation, performance declines and blunders creep in.

Procedural conformity with flexibility. You must understand the emergency strategy chilly, yet also identify when conditions require inconsistency. In a fire door repair situation, the planned emptying route could be endangered. Under PUAFER006, you are expected to observe the deviation and reroute securely, not plough ahead due to the fact that the manual claimed so.

Interface with outside services. When advanced chief warden program fire staffs show up, the chief warden supplies a succinct handover, after that sustains their procedure by keeping cordons, resident control, and systems info. A sharp handover is less than 60 seconds and has developing layout, fire panel points, hazards, status of residents, and systems actions taken.

Post incident leadership. Accountability does not end with the all‑clear. You require to coordinate the debrief, compile occurrence reports, start rehabilitative activities, and recover normal procedures. Good principal wardens treat each occasion as a discovering loop for the ECO and the business.

How PUAFER006 and PUAFER005 relate

Think of PUAFER005 as the foundation and PUAFER006 as the command layer. The initial trains wardens to inspect restrooms, close doors, move zones, help individuals with impairment, and report problems. The second trains you to transform those wardens right into a synchronised group. In a genuine structure you desire both. A durable warden course for the group, typically called fire warden training or emergency warden training, develops the muscular tissue memory for activity. A focused chief warden course builds decision quality and control.

Most training service providers plan PUAFER005 course and PUAFER006 course components with each other or in turn. If you manage training for numerous sites, run PUAFER005 operate as part of an emergency control organisation early and revitalize yearly, after that cycle your likely future leaders via chief warden training every 2 to 3 years. Skills fade if they are not exercised.

Core situations to master

PUAFER006 expects proficiency across several emergency kinds, not just fire. In practice, you should practice at the very least five high‑frequency or high‑impact occasions for your center type. The copying highlight the decisions that identify sufficient from excellent.

Fire alarm system, unidentified reason. The panel reveals a detector activated on Degree 3 near a kitchen space. Preliminary action is investigate and standby. The nearest location warden relocates to confirm while the chief warden settings at the control point, checks CCTV if available, and prepares messages. If smoke shows up or the warden reports heat, boost to partial emptying of the affected area. A complete structure discharge might be too much in a tower with zoned pressurisation, however you need to consider smoke movement, at risk occupants, and system standing. Announcements must be clear and quick, with repeats every 60 to 90 seconds till the emptying stage ends.

Hazardous spill. A pallet drops and bursts a drum of solvent. The chief warden isolates the area by shutting doors and limiting air activity, verifies the Security Information Sheet, initiates a targeted discharge, and shuts out ignition sources. Calling an external HAZMAT device early pays dividends. The mistake I see is over‑evacuation that sends people past the danger. Alternate leave courses should become part of the strategy, and the ECO ought to practice their signs and stewardship.

Medical emergency situation in a group. A person collapses during an entrance hall event. The chief warden appoints a warden to crowd control, secures an AED, and creates a corridor for paramedics. If the person is infectious or there is a bloodborne danger, the ECO should rise cleaning procedures and get in touch with mapping according to the health plan. The failure pattern is too many assistants, not nearly enough space and air. The very best principal wardens hold the perimeter and keep onlookers out while the first aiders work.

Power failing with lift entrapments. Power outages increase stress and anxiety fast. The chief warden causes owner messaging to preserve phone batteries and sit tight unless an emptying is necessary. Security collaborates with the lift professional while wardens move stairwells to look for stuck individuals. If smoke ventilation depends on power, you have to examine whether to keep individuals in position or relocate them to much safer areas. After 10 to 15 minutes, offer a standing upgrade even if nothing has transformed. Silence types panic.

Threats to personal safety and security. Hostile persons or suspect bundles require a various position. You may need to secure down, limit access, and divert individuals away from areas without promoting the reason broadly. The communications stance matters. Generic language such as "avoid the entrance hall and comply with warden instructions" secures privacy and reduces threat till police arrives.

Communications self-control and the radio problem

In the first minute of an event, radios can transform to mayhem if you have actually not pierced message framework. One site I collaborated with had 18 radios live during a sprinkler activation. Everybody talked at once, and the chief warden missed out on the critical update that the valve had been isolated. We repaired it with radio web discipline and brevity codes tailored to the building.

Keep channels few and concentrated. If you have 2 channels, assign one to life safety and one to design or assistance, and park all inessential babble. Use telephone call signs that match roles, not names. Practice closed‑loop interaction. When a warden acknowledges a guideline, they repeat the crucial facts: "Area Warden South, evacuate Degree 2 west wing to Assembly B, duplicate." That behavior costs a second and protects against a lots errors.

For structures without radios, the communications warden comes to be the hub. They need a log, a peaceful area, and the authority to triage inbound details. Mobile phones are a fallback but breakable, particularly in a power occasion. Consider hard‑wired phones near stair doors, whiteboards for tasks, and runners in high‑rise websites where radio propagation is patchy.

Evacuation nuances couple of talk about

If you have just ever before drilled a full building emptying on a warm early morning, you could be surprised at the rubbing factors that emerge under stress. Stairwell characteristics transform with pushchairs, walking sticks, and panic. Individuals sluggish at the initial spin in the stairway since they do not know what is in advance. Wardens who organize at touchdown transforms smooth the circulation and maintain individuals moving.

Assembly location choice issues. Too close, and you crowd the exterior and hamper -responders. Too much, and you lose people to the coffee bar. Select a location that permits head count without road going across preferably. Have a second area if wind or threats make the first hazardous. Videotape where you sent out individuals, because responders will ask.

Lifts are a touchy topic. Several contemporary structures have resident emptying elevators developed for use in fire under supervision. If your building has them, your plan must include explicit guidelines, qualified lift wardens, and intermediary with the fire brigade. If your building does not, your ECO requires to oversee presented activity so those that require more time begin previously. The chief warden manages the tempo and keeps the stairwell from stacking up.

Integrating persons with handicap and access needs

Fire warden requirements in the workplace consist of planning for owners and visitors with short-term and permanent gain access to requirements. Do not depend on impromptu goodwill. Personal Emergency situation Evacuation Strategies make a difference, however they only function if a person possesses them and they are tested. In a multi‑tenant building, sychronisation in between renters assists prevent replication and spaces. Evacuation chairs require training and method in the real stairwell. Appoint pairs to each tool and practice handovers every landing.

In one drill at a health and wellness center, a warden team attempted to muscle an evacuation chair with one person. They made it, barely, and both were exhausted. The restorative activity was basic: add a 2nd warden, established the tempo, and train on the braking system. PUAFER006 expects the chief warden to set standards like this, examine them, and readjust based upon evidence.

Documentation that gains its keep

Emergency strategies commonly end up being shelfware, took out for audits and neglected. That is a missed opportunity. The most effective strategies I have actually seen do 3 points: they make decisions less complicated throughout a case, they make training sensible, and they hold people accountable afterward.

Make fast referral guides for wardens and the chief warden that reflect your site, not common designs. Include panel screenshots, shutoff and isolation points, gas shutoff areas, and specialized risks such as lithium battery storage space. Maintain the papers short. Laminated cards on lanyards or pockets function when nerves battle royal. Include a call cascade for after hours and specialists that can close points down fast.

After each occasion or drill, the chief warden ought to lead a short, time‑boxed debrief. What did we intend, what happened, what aided, what hindered, what will certainly we transform by following quarter. Capture metrics like time to ECO activation, time to initial warden record, time to emptying conclusion, and percent of wardens existing. Run a rehabilitative activities log with owners and dates. When auditors inquire about chief fire warden responsibilities, show them the log. It is the sensible evidence that the plan is alive.

Working with building systems, not against them

Modern buildings have complex user interfaces: fire indicator panels, emergency caution and intercommunication systems, smoke control systems, sprinklers, gas detection, and a lot more. Chief warden responsibilities include recognizing exactly how these systems behave and how your actions engage with them.

During a fire occasion, door releases, smoke exhaust followers, and stairway pressurisation can change airflow drastically. Propping stairway doors open beats the pressurisation system and fills up stairways with smoke. Wardens need to recognize why doors need to stay shut, not simply that they must.

Test your Public Address system degrees throughout drills. In a hectic storehouse, forklifts drown out messages unless the speaker positioning and quantity are tuned. An interactions warden with a portable loudhailer is a useful back-up. Check that videotaped messages are intelligible and match your plan language. If your EWIS says one point and your wardens say one more, people stop listening.

Legal duties and functional thresholds

Chief fire warden requirements do not replace legal obligations under work environment health and safety laws or state fire solutions regulation. If you handle a site, you are accountable for making sure the fire warden requirements in the workplace are met: appropriate numbers of trained wardens, maintained systems, up‑to‑date layouts, and evaluated treatments. Regulatory authorities and insurance companies do decline "we planned to educate them next quarter" after an avoidable injury.

At the exact same time, the legislation recognises that choices are made under uncertainty. Record the basis for your decisions throughout an incident, especially if you deviate from the strategy. If a stairwell was jeopardized and you presented a partial sanctuary in position, keep in mind the signs, the time, and the communications. That document shows diligence.
